      What is the definition of Atrial Fibrillation?

      Atrial fibrillation (AF), also known as A-fib, is the most common type of irregular heartbeat (arrythmia) of the heart’s upper chambers (atria) which can lead to strokes, heart failure, blood clots in the heart and/or blockage of blood flow (ischemia) in the heart or other organs. Atrial fibrillation is frequently combined with a rapid heart rate (tachycardia) and occurs when the upper chambers of the heart (atria) receive abnormal electrical signals from the heart’s conduction system that causes the atria to quiver. Atrial fibrillation is categorized by the following four main types: Occasional (Paroxysmal) atrial fibrillation – This type of atrial fibrillation comes and goes, can last from minutes to hours, or even last as long as a week, or occur repeatedly, and may go away on its own. Persistent atrial fibrillation – In this type of atrial fibrillation, the irregular heart rhythm (arrythmia) doesn’t go away on its own and needs treatment to restore normal rhythm. Long-standing persistent atrial fibrillation – This type of atrial fibrillation occurs continuously, lasting longer than 12 months. Permanent atrial fibrillation – In this type of atrial fibrillation, the irregular heart rhythm cannot be restored to normal, in which case it becomes permanent, requiring heart medications and anticoagulants to prevent blood clots. Atrial fibrillation that occurs in individuals who do not have any heart defects or damage is called lone atrial fibrillation.

      Why is it important to get a second opinion from a different Atrial Fibrillation doctor?

      Second opinions are an opportunity to confirm a diagnosis and its root cause, learn about alternative treatment options, or simply gain peace of mind. Many people, especially those with serious diagnoses, get second opinions so they can understand all their options and make informed decisions, so don’t hesitate to get one if you have any doubts or need more information or clarification regarding your care. Note that some insurance plans require second opinions, while others don’t cover second opinions, so be sure to confirm with your insurance provider first.   

      How can I prepare for my appointment with an Atrial Fibrillation doctor near Newburgh, NY?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
